NHTSA Safety Investigations, INFINITI QX50

Investigations opened by NHTSA into potential safety defects. These are separate from recalls and may or may not result in a recall.

PE23023 Opened: Dec 13, 2023 , Closed: Jul 18, 2025
PE, Closed , Model Year: 2019
Complete loss of motive power due to engine failure
On December 13, 2023, the Office of Defects Investigation (ODI) opened PE23-023 to investigate allegations of engine failures leading to loss of motive power in model year (MY) 2021-2023 Nissan Rogue; MY 2019-2021 Nissan Altima; and MY 2019-2021 Infiniti QX50 vehicles.
